Understand this, my dear brothers and sisters: You must all be quick to listen, slow to speak, and slow to get angry. (James 1: 19 NLT)

Early morning dawns, my sleepy eyes slowly open and adjust to sunlight peeking through the window blinds. Yawning and stretching, I prepare to rise from the comfortable bed.

Before my feet touch the floor, I pause. I am still and calm. I listen for Him. “Good morning, dear Lord. Thank You for this glorious day.” Sometimes I speak aloud and other times the words are spoken in my thoughts.

He welcomes me to conversation. A blessed way to start the day, praising and thanking Him for the blessings He provides.

“Thank You for sleep, a comfortable bed, a loving family – and thank You for loving me. You, Lord, are my rock. You comfort me and give me strength.”

I share my thoughts,

knowing He is hearing every word.

God has plans for me this day and every day. I pray I will pause and listen for His direction instead of following my own way. When things don’t go as planned and my feelings are hurt, I will remember the comfort He gives.

The day continues with opportunities to share His love and forgiveness with others. Will I remember the morning conversation with Him? Or will life become so busy with errands, appointments, meetings, preparing meals, work, family time, and more that I forget the calmness of the precious moments shared with Him in the morning?

In busy times, stress can cause tiredness and grouchiness may arise. I must remember James 1:19 and follow His directions.

I pause and again I listen for Him. A tired body and mind will not cause me to forget His Words.

I will listen to my family, friends, neighbors, and strangers. I will be slow to speak. If I don’t agree with the opinion of another person, I won’t get angry. I will listen as He listens to me.

Day has come and gone. Preparing for another night of sleep, I thank Him. I pause and listen. Yes, I hear Him.

Do you hear Him? He is waiting for conversation with you. Thank Him. Praise Him. Give Him your burdens. He is listening. Anytime, night or day, He is waiting with open arms to listen to you.

Yes, He loves you.
